Output db14d03b90c530798dbf754c89765386b5e065be2e13592a899124b5ee788aa6: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de059ecd1dfccc5b6ac8c59017d9f8d86003ed5e OP_EQUAL
address
3MvxfdsnJ3PprcAupdoVseC4QCnXmQoTJb
transaction
db14d03b90c530798dbf754c89765386b5e065be2e13592a899124b5ee788aa6
confirmations
81673
spent
true